summaryrefslogtreecommitdiff
path: root/ishtar_common/models.py
diff options
context:
space:
mode:
authorroot <root@viserion.(none)>2013-04-30 15:27:34 +0000
committerroot <root@viserion.(none)>2013-04-30 15:27:34 +0000
commit03f21b1abbae8962c81f46c01f1bb972fc7b2395 (patch)
tree5f5652a1fb2027bbf4dd1dc26d6e28cbc04ea8fb /ishtar_common/models.py
parent16e1f93de47184e52765f950e39cb04f6ed93dd8 (diff)
parenteadca6ca09b823da4596b7b904420e6314383b50 (diff)
downloadIshtar-03f21b1abbae8962c81f46c01f1bb972fc7b2395.tar.bz2
Ishtar-03f21b1abbae8962c81f46c01f1bb972fc7b2395.zip
Merge branch 'master' of lysithea.proxience.net:/home/proxience/git/ishtar
Diffstat (limited to 'ishtar_common/models.py')
-rw-r--r--ishtar_common/models.py10
1 files changed, 4 insertions, 6 deletions
diff --git a/ishtar_common/models.py b/ishtar_common/models.py
index 61c7de7ff..8fcfacc9a 100644
--- a/ishtar_common/models.py
+++ b/ishtar_common/models.py
@@ -578,12 +578,10 @@ class Person(Address, OwnPerms) :
)
def __unicode__(self):
- lbl = u"%s %s" % (self.name, self.surname)
- if self.attached_to:
- lbl += settings.JOINT + unicode(self.attached_to)
- elif self.email:
- lbl += settings.JOINT + self.email
- return lbl
+ values = [unicode(getattr(self, attr))
+ for attr in ('surname', 'name', 'attached_to')
+ if getattr(self, attr)]
+ return u" ".join(values)
def full_label(self):
values = []